WebMar 30, 2024 · Population change. Greater Adelaide increased by 16,100 people (1.2%), the rest of the state increased by 1,600 (0.4%). The areas with the largest growth were: Munno Para West - Angle Vale (up by 970 people) on the northern outskirts of Adelaide. Mount Barker (950 people) in the Adelaide Hills.
